Operating Income is the amount of profit realized from Advanced Micro Devices operations after accounting for operating expenses such as cost of goods sold (COGS), wages and depreciation. Operating income takes the gross income and subtracts other operating expenses and then removes depreciation. Operating Income of Advanced Micro Devices is typically a synonym for earnings before interest and taxes (EBIT) and is also commonly referred to as operating profit or recurring profit.
